Check out this polycarbonate dessicator. I rescued it from the recycle/trash bin. My wife just shook her head. :rolleyes: I'm turning it into a see-through humi. It's in great shape and has minimal scratches. It cleaned up well. It's a 12" cube and is 3/8" thick. Nice stainless piano hinge, stainless clasps, and a solid seal. Three shelves (with holes) and a bottom pan.
